It translates between two supply domains: VCCA from 0.9 V to 5.5 V and VCCB from 1.65 V to 5.5 V, covering the common logic families from sub-1V cores up to legacy 5V peripherals. Rated for 20 Mbps data rate, this part handles SPI, UART, and I²C buses running at standard and fast speeds without adding propagation-delay margin problems. The bidirectional channel type eliminates the need for a direction-control signal — the translator senses the drive direction on each channel independently. ## Output configuration and bus topology Each channel's output type is configurable as open-drain, push-pull, or tri-state. Open-drain mode suits multi-drop I²C or SMBus lines where multiple drivers share a pull-up resistor; push-pull mode gives faster edge rates for point-to-point SPI without external resistors. Tri-state lets the translator float off the bus during power sequencing or partial shutdown. The part integrates power-supply decoupling and thermal-shutdown protection on-chip — the decoupling reduces external capacitor count near the translator, and the thermal shutdown protects against a sustained output short or over-temperature event on the board. The exposed paddle is the thermal and electrical ground reference — the datasheet's recommended footprint shows a 2.1x2.1 mm solder-paste aperture on the centre pad. Operating temperature range is -40°C to +85°C, covering industrial enclosures and outdoor telecom cabinets without a grade bump. Mounting is surface-mount only — no through-hole variant exists.","metaTitle":"MAX14611ETD+T Bidirectional Level Translator, 20Mbps","metaDescription":"MAX14611ETD+T voltage-level translator from Analog Devices. 4-channel bidirectional, 20Mbps data rate, 0.9V-5.5V VCCA, 1.65V-5.5V VCCB.
